The Rise of Tristen Keys: A Phenomenal Talent

Tristen Keys is a name that has been circling the recruiting circuit for quite some time. Hailing from a high school in Louisiana, Keys has been a standout player since his early years on the football field. His combination of size, speed, and ball skills has made him one of the most coveted recruits in the country. Standing at 6’3″ and weighing 195 pounds, Keys has the frame and physicality to dominate at the next level. But it’s his speed and agility that truly set him apart. Keys possesses an explosive first step and is capable of taking any play to the house, whether it’s a quick slant, a deep post route, or a screen pass that he can turn into a long touchdown.

In his high school career, Keys has compiled impressive statistics that demonstrate his versatility. Whether it’s as a deep threat, a physical possession receiver, or a player who can make an impact on special teams, Keys is capable of doing it all. His ability to create separation from defenders and his knack for making plays in clutch situations are qualities that have consistently drawn comparisons to some of the best wide receivers in college football history.
